Abstract

The results of research by Anisa, R in 2022 on cleaning staff in the city of Banjarbaru showed that dental and oral health knowledge was still in the poor category, 71% and dental and oral hygiene was 60%, still in the poor category. This is because the janitor has never received education about dental and oral health. The results of the DMF-T examination of the cleaning officers showed that the average DMF-T was 5.8, meaning that each cleaning officer experienced caries in 5-6 teeth ranging from shallow to deep caries, fissures in 15 teeth in the permanent first and second molars. The aim of this Community Service is to increase knowledge, take preventive measures and carry out simple dental care. The method used is to provide education through counseling, dental examinations and dental care. The target of community service is 93 Banjarbaru city cleaning officers. The methods used are counseling, mass tooth brushing, scaling, fissure sealant, and filling. The time period was 2 (two) months, namely September-October 2023. Achievements and Conclusions After implementing Community Service, the target of good knowledge increased to 60%, Dental and Oral Hygiene became good 58.1%, Internal fissures became 1 tooth, Dental caries 97 teeth down to 49 teeth.

Abstract

Initial knowledge about the community's dental and oral health was on average 55.60 (medium) after counseling increased quite significantly to an average knowledge of 66.63 (high) (Syahputri et al., n.d.). When examining the caries experience (DMF-T) of 116 students, it was found that the average DMF-T number was 2.32 (in the medium category). After treatment was carried out, the caries number could be reduced to 0.77 (low category), achieving the DMF-T reduction rate. T can be maximized because all students are cooperative so that cavities can be filled/simple procedures can be done. Business Activities to reduce the number of cavities/caries from 180 cases to 0 cases of which 180 cases can be carried out with simple fillings (100%). Meanwhile, the Performance Treatment Index (PTI) in this activity increased quite significantly, from 0% to 100%, this was because the students were cooperative and understood how to maintain good and correct dental health. Keywords: Prevention of Dental and Oral Diseases

Abstract

Caries is a disease that is still a major problem in the field of dental health in the world, including in Indonesia. Various efforts must continue to be made to reduce the incidence of caries, both promotive and preventive, as well as curative and rehabilitative. The DMF-T index in Banjar Regency is 7.8 with D-T=1.62, M-T=5.88, and F-T=0.34 and is one of the districts that has a DMF-T value above the index for South Kalimantan province. The results of the 2016 Banjar District Health Service survey stated that the highest number of permanent tooth fillings and extractions was in Martapura District with a total of 1148 permanent tooth fillings and 895 permanent tooth extractions. Community service aims to increase knowledge of dental and oral health and brushing skills, increase PTI rates and reduce dental caries rates in the community in Pekauman village, Banjar Regency, East Martapura District on the Martapura River. The method used is analytical observational with a cross sectional approach. The community service population is the people of Pekauman Village, Banjar Regency, East Martapura District on the the Martapura River. As a result of community service, there was an increase in knowledge about dental health from an average of 52.40 high criteria to very high 83.27. The achievement of reducing the number of dental caries by 27.43% and increasing the Performance Treatment Index (PTI) number was achieved from 3.6% to 23%. Keywords: Knowledge, dental caries rates, PTI rates

Abstract

Malaria remains a problem in Indonesia and in the world with morbidity and mortality rates quite high, caused by Anopheles mosquitoes which carry the Plasmodium sp parasite. Malaria has an impact on reducing hemoglobin levels in the blood which causes anemia. Forest workers are vulnerable to malaria and anemia. Lack of knowledge can be a factor in increasing the incidence of malaria and anemia. This community service activity aims to increase knowledge about malaria, improve malaria prevention attitudes and behavior, detect malaria and anemia in workers by laboratory examination. Implementation methods include counseling, questionnaires, observations, and laboratory examinations for malaria detection by Rapid Diagnostic Test (RDT) and Microscopic technique, Determine hemoglobin (Hb) levels using Point of Care Testing (POCT) method as an indicator of anemia in blood specimens of 50 forest workers in Aranio District. The results of this activity increased the knowledge, attitudes, and behavior of respondents regarding malaria prevention to 100%, malaria laboratory examinations both RDT and microscopic results were 100% negative. The Hb levels obtained ranged from 8.4 gr/dl to 15.2 g/dl which 35 respondents (70%) were normal and 15 respondents (30%) were below normal or anemia. Another outcome was the formation of the community group “Kelaan Block and Prevent Malaria Transmission“. It is recommended for further community service to continue with other programs based on the Healthy Village concept to prevent and maintain malaria elimination status in the Aranio area that supports the realization of health transformation in Indonesia. Keywords: Counseling, Knowledge, Malaria, Anemia, Forest Workers
